Pinealon
Pinealon is a synthetic short-chain tripeptide composed of three amino acids: glutamic acid, aspartic acid and arginine (EDR). It has been studied primarily in experimental research focusing on neurobiological processes, cellular signalling and age-associated changes.
Laboratory investigations have explored Pinealon in relation to neuronal function, oxidative-stress responses, gene expression and cellular protection mechanisms. It is also of interest in research examining how short-chain peptides may influence cellular regulation and tissue homeostasis.
Pinealon is therefore mainly discussed within peptide, molecular biology, neuroscience and ageing-related research, with findings largely derived from experimental and preclinical models.
